Blue Heather vs Pine Needle
Where Blue Heather belongs to Benjamin Moore's range, Pine Needle is a Dulux color. Blue Heather reads as blue, while Pine Needle reads as green — two distinct hue families, not close cousins. Blue Heather (LRV 51) reflects noticeably more light than Pine Needle (LRV 7), a difference of 44 points that becomes especially apparent in rooms with limited natural light. Blue Heather runs blue while Pine Needle is decidedly cool, which means they'll respond very differently to warm vs cool light sources. With a ΔE of 50.2, the contrast is hard to miss.
